We reopen for the 2017 season on Sunday 16 April from 11am – 5pm, and will then be open every Sunday and Bank Holiday until the end of October.

Locomotive “Sir Tatton Sykes” will be in operation all day (subject to availability). Entrance to the site and visitor centre is free, with a small charge being made for cab rides.

The big news for 2017 is the proposed extension in to what we refer to as field 2. The perimeter of this large extension to more than double the existing track length is currently being marked out. However, due to a major funding application we are currently submitting, we have had to put actual tracklaying on hold as part of the bid criteria. Construction will resume once the outcome of the bid has been realised which should be around July/August.
